Abstract

KIC 2835289 is a triple stellar system that consists of an inner ellipsoidal\nvariable with an orbital period of ~0.86 days and an outer star that eclipses\nthe inner pair every ~750 days. Two eclipse events were observed by the Kepler\nmission, but they do not fully constrain our photodynamical models. The next\neclipse event will occur on May 14 UT, and we solicit community involvement to\nfollow it up from the ground.
